Understanding Your Pain

What is Ankle Pain and Why Does It Happen?

Ankle pain refers to discomfort, stiffness, or swelling in the ankle joint that can affect your ability to walk, stand, or perform daily activities comfortably. Ankle pain and swelling often occur together and can worsen significantly over time if not treated properly.

Many people in Kolkata ignore early symptoms, thinking it is a minor issue. But without proper diagnosis, ankle pain often keeps returning — and what starts as a simple sprain can develop into a chronic ankle ligament injury or long-term instability.

Our goal is not just to reduce pain temporarily but to restore full ankle strength, stability, and movement so you can return to your normal lifestyle with confidence.

Conditions We Treat

Types of Ankle Injuries and Conditions We Treat in Kolkata

Each ankle condition requires a different treatment approach. Proper professional assessment is essential to identify exactly what you are dealing with before treatment begins.

Ankle Sprain

Mild to severe stretching or tearing of the ankle ligaments. The most common ankle injury — treated with structured physiotherapy to restore movement, strength, and stability.

Ankle Ligament Injury

Partial or complete ligament tears that cause pain, swelling, and instability. Proper rehabilitation is essential to prevent the injury from becoming a long-term problem.

Chronic Ankle Instability

Repeated ankle giving way — often a result of a previous sprain that was not fully rehabilitated. Requires targeted strengthening and proprioception training to resolve.

Foot and Ankle Pain

Combined foot and ankle discomfort often related to flat feet, alignment issues, or overuse. Assessment of the whole lower limb is essential for effective treatment.

Sports-Related Ankle Injuries

Injuries from football, cricket, running, gym, and court sports. Rehabilitation includes sports-specific exercises and a structured return-to-activity plan.

Post-Injury Stiffness and Weakness

Reduced mobility and strength following an ankle injury or period of immobilisation. Requires progressive physiotherapy to restore full function and prevent re-injury.

Our Treatment Approach

Ankle Pain Treatment in Kolkata — Our Step-by-Step Approach

At Shape and Strength, we follow a structured and proven approach. Treatment is always personalised to your specific injury, pain level, and recovery goals.

01

Detailed Assessment

We identify the exact cause of your ankle pain — whether it is a ligament injury, muscle weakness, joint instability, or alignment issue — before beginning any treatment.

02

Pain and Swelling Management

Safe physiotherapy techniques reduce inflammation, swelling, and discomfort in the ankle joint — allowing active rehabilitation to begin as soon as possible.

03

Restore Movement

Gentle, guided exercises improve ankle flexibility and mobility — restoring the range of motion needed for comfortable walking, standing, and daily activities.

04

Strength Building

Targeted strengthening of the muscles around the ankle joint provides stability and reduces the load placed on ligaments during movement and activity.

05

Balance and Control Training

Balance and proprioception exercises restore the ankle's ability to react to sudden movements — an essential step in preventing future ankle injuries.

06

Return to Activity

A structured plan guides you safely back to your normal routine, sport, or workout — with specific milestones to ensure the ankle is fully ready before full activity resumes.

Ankle pain without a clear injury can result from several causes — including overuse, poor footwear, flat feet, alignment problems, weak muscles around the joint, or a previous injury that was not fully rehabilitated. Chronic ankle instability from an old unresolved sprain is one of the most common causes of recurring ankle pain in Kolkata. A professional physiotherapy assessment is the only reliable way to identify the exact cause and begin the right treatment.
Proper treatment of an ankle ligament injury includes accurate diagnosis of the injury severity, controlled movement and protection in the early stage, gradual strengthening exercises as healing progresses, balance and stability training, and a structured return to normal activity. Attempting random exercises without professional guidance can significantly worsen ligament damage — which is why physiotherapy-led treatment is essential.
Recovery time depends on the severity of the ankle sprain. Mild sprains can recover in 1 to 3 weeks with proper physiotherapy. Moderate sprains typically take 4 to 8 weeks. Severe sprains involving significant ligament damage may take 3 to 6 months for full recovery. Consistent physiotherapy and not returning to activity too early are the most important factors in complete recovery without re-injury.
An ankle that repeatedly gives way is a sign of chronic ankle instability — most often caused by a previous sprain that was not fully rehabilitated. The ligaments and muscles surrounding the joint did not fully recover their strength and proprioception, leaving the ankle vulnerable to repeated injury. Targeted physiotherapy focusing on ligament strengthening and balance training is the most effective treatment for this condition.
No — ankle surgery is not required in the majority of ligament injury cases. Most ankle sprains and partial ligament tears respond very well to structured physiotherapy without surgical intervention. Surgery is only considered in cases of complete ligament rupture where conservative treatment has not produced adequate stability.
